Normandy Le Chantier is a Paris hotel located about 1mi from the city center, at 7, Rue De Lechelle. Minimum price starts from $137 per night. With 2088 reviews, this property welcomes travelers to its Parisian address and keeps a long-running guest record.
Featured amenities include pet-friendly options (extra charges), a restaurant, free wifi, a bar, a sun deck, a tour desk, and soundproof rooms. Practical touches include a 24-hour front desk, non-smoking rooms, an elevator, upper floors accessible by elevator, extra-long beds (>6.5 ft), free toiletries, and soundproofing. Meeting or banquet facilities are available for an extra charge.

Harrison
10
February 2025
It is rare that I provide feedback on any hotel, but I felt that in the case of Normandy Le Chantier, they are deserving of my time. Neither my wife nor I had been to Paris since school and it was our teenage daughter's first trip, and so we had no expectations, other than the photos of the hotel which drew us to book with you in the first place. From the outset, the reception staff were welcoming as we left our bags early in the day to start exploring, and the colourful reception was intriguing. We returned later in the day tired and found our room. Stunningly and querkily decorated, with the longest sink we've ever seen and a walk-in shower with two showers, we were impressed. Our daughter, who is ready for her own hotel room, loved that she had a separate area to us with her own TV. So to the next morning and the breakfast room is stunning, an extremely tall and absolutely stunning room, let alone the breakfast which was delicious and the word continental does not do it justice. Later, we tried the Mexican restaurant, which is part of the hotel. It is a short menu, but that did not matter as the food was tasty, as were the cocktails. That a fussy eater loved it, says it all. Our final treat of our far too few days here was to try the creperie... to find we wish we'd been more than once. Normandy Le Chantier and its staff gave us a wonderful and relaxed trip to Paris. Thank you, and we'll recommend you to anyone, and we'll be back.

Guest
9.1
September 2024
When entering the hotel for the first time, the lobby may look somewhat peculiar and artistic, but you quickly get accustomed to that. As is mentioned on the hotel’s website, it is still under reconstruction (summer 2024, le chantier = the construction site). Although some reviews suggest otherwise, we did not experience any hindrance from reconstruction activities (maybe because of the holidays). The room we had, with a separate bedroom, was spacious compared to Paris standards. Also it was well maintained, quite modern, very clean and very quiet. The hotel is at a wonderful central location, just 100 meters from the Louvre museum. within walking distance of many other Paris highlights, with a nearby metro station (Pyramides) to bring you anywhere in Paris and with many restaurants and cafés in the direct vicinity. We found the breakfast to be very good, with coffee/cappuccino freshly made for you, fresh orange juice and ample choice of food. The staff are very friendly, always willing to help. All in all, a very nice stay at a perfect location.
